一、平台定位与技术架构设计
云资源交易平台作为连接内容创作者与消费者的桥梁,需同时满足用户自主定价、安全交易、版权合规三大核心需求。系统架构通常采用分层设计:
- 接入层:提供Web/H5/API等多端访问能力,支持商品展示、搜索、交易等基础功能
- 业务层:包含商品管理、订单处理、支付结算、争议仲裁等核心模块
- 数据层:存储商品元数据、交易记录、用户行为日志等结构化数据
- 支撑层:集成对象存储、消息队列、分布式锁等云原生组件
典型技术栈示例:
前端:Vue3 + TypeScript + Ant Design后端:Spring Cloud Alibaba微服务架构数据库:MySQL(业务数据)+ MongoDB(日志数据)存储:对象存储服务(支持大文件分片上传)支付:第三方担保支付接口集成
二、核心交易流程实现
1. 商品发布系统
商品上架需经过三个关键步骤:
- 资源校验:通过文件指纹比对检测重复内容,使用MD5/SHA1算法生成唯一标识
- 元数据录入:要求卖家填写分类、标题、描述、定价等结构化信息
- 自动生成链接:采用UUID算法生成商品唯一ID,拼接成可分享的短链接
示例商品发布接口:
@PostMapping("/api/v1/items")public ResponseEntity<ItemDTO> createItem(@RequestBody ItemCreateRequest request,@AuthenticationPrincipal UserDetails user) {// 1. 校验文件合法性FileValidationResult result = fileValidator.validate(request.getFile());if (!result.isValid()) {throw new BusinessException("INVALID_FILE_TYPE");}// 2. 生成商品唯一标识String itemId = UUID.randomUUID().toString();// 3. 存储元数据ItemEntity item = itemRepository.save(new ItemEntity(itemId, user.getUsername(), request.getPrice()));return ResponseEntity.ok(itemConverter.convert(item));}
2. 担保交易系统
交易流程需实现资金流与物流的分离控制:
- 预授权阶段:买家支付资金进入监管账户,系统生成加密交易凭证
- 资源交付阶段:卖家上传完整文件后,系统自动触发买家下载链接生成
- 确认收货阶段:买家在72小时确认期后,系统自动完成资金划转
关键技术实现:
def execute_transaction(transaction_id):# 查询交易状态tx = Transaction.query.get(transaction_id)if tx.status != 'PAID':raise Exception("Invalid transaction status")# 获取加密资源链接encrypted_url = generate_encrypted_url(tx.item_id)# 更新交易状态tx.status = 'DELIVERED'tx.delivery_time = datetime.now()db.session.commit()# 通知买家send_delivery_notification(tx.buyer_id, encrypted_url)
3. 争议处理机制
需建立三级争议处理体系:
- 自动仲裁:通过交易日志分析判断明显违规行为(如未交付文件)
- 人工复核:组建专业审核团队处理复杂争议案件
- 上诉通道:提供司法鉴定机构接入接口,支持法律程序取证
争议处理状态机设计:
stateDiagram-v2[*] --> SUBMITTEDSUBMITTED --> UNDER_REVIEW: 自动初审UNDER_REVIEW --> RESOLVED: 达成一致UNDER_REVIEW --> ESCALATED: 升级处理ESCALATED --> ARBITRATED: 最终裁决ARBITRATED --> CLOSED: 结案
三、合规运营关键要素
1. 版权风险管理
- 事前预防:建立内容黑名单库,集成第三方版权检测API
- 事中监控:通过OCR/语音识别技术检测侵权内容
- 事后处置:制定分级处罚制度(警告→限流→封号)
2. 资金安全保障
- 分账系统:采用银行级资金清算架构,确保交易资金隔离
- 合规审计:完整记录资金流向,满足反洗钱监管要求
- 灾备方案:实现跨可用区数据同步,保障业务连续性
3. 用户体验优化
- 智能推荐:基于协同过滤算法实现个性化商品推荐
- 多端适配:开发Progressive Web App提升移动端体验
- 性能优化:通过CDN加速和预加载技术缩短页面响应时间
四、典型失败案例分析
某平台2013年上线后24小时下架事件揭示三大教训:
- 版权审核缺位:未建立内容审核机制导致大量侵权内容流通
- 资金监管缺失:采用直连支付模式引发用户资金安全担忧
- 争议处理滞后:缺乏自动化处理系统导致投诉积压
五、平台运营数据指标
建议重点监控以下核心指标:
| 指标类别 | 关键指标 | 目标值范围 |
|————————|—————————————-|——————-|
| 交易健康度 | 争议率 | <0.5% |
| 用户体验 | 商品发布成功率 | >98% |
| 运营效率 | 平均争议处理时长 | <12小时 |
| 商业价值 | 人均交易额 | 持续提升 |
六、技术演进方向
- 区块链应用:利用智能合约实现交易不可篡改
- AI审核升级:部署多模态内容识别模型提升审核效率
- 边缘计算:通过CDN节点实现就近内容分发
云资源交易平台的成功构建需要技术实现与合规运营的双重保障。开发者应重点关注交易流程的安全性设计、版权风险的防控机制以及用户体验的持续优化,同时建立完善的监控体系确保平台稳定运行。在版权保护日益严格的今天,只有将技术创新与合规运营有机结合,才能打造可持续发展的数字内容交易生态。